Good things to know
Which word is more common?
Clearness is less commonly used than transparency in everyday language. Transparency is a more versatile word that can be used in various contexts, including business, politics, and personal relationships. Clearness is more specific and tends to be used in technical or academic settings.
Whatโs the difference in the tone of formality between clearness and transparency?
Both clearness and transparency can be used in formal and informal contexts. However, clearness may be perceived as slightly more formal due to its association with technical or academic language, while transparency is commonly used in both formal and informal settings.
